A woman in a blue dress with a green sash stands in front of a jazz band, each performer with their own instrument. The woman’s hands are outstretched in a flourish, her instrument is her voice as she sings to the audience, or in this case the viewers who stand in place of the traditional audience. The rich watercolors of this painting bleed into one another in an interesting contrast as some places of the page are vibrant and dense with pigment, while others are practically bare.
